800 Carolina Cir Sw, Vero Beach, FL 32962New Indian River Club in Vero Beach has accumulated 223 violations across 28 inspections since 2016, averaging 8 per visit. The facility issued warnings in 2021, 2023, and 2024 for violations including consumer advisory failures and food contact surface issues, but has since improved markedly. The most recent four inspections show no violations or only minor infractions, suggesting corrective action has taken hold.
Summary generated from Florida DBPR public inspection records.
